Unhappy Property Owner

Do any of you know how to find out who actually owns a property (website, etc.)? I'm not sure who to call with TV....Deed Compliance, main office,? The property behind us is not being kept up as it should and is a long-term rental. So far, Deed Compliance has not resolved the issue of the barking dogs there so I'm not sure they would handle anything else, since the occupants are renters. Yes, I love dogs but not when they bark all hours of the day and night, sometimes pretty much all day. I know that the guy who owns it has a private "property manager", but I don't know who she is. I put the title in quotes because so far I can't see what she "manages". The lawn is full of weeds and that's pretty much the green part. I pay to have mine weeded, fed, and maintained. It's getting to be a losing battle in the back because they don't even water. Help!

I'd call deed compliance for the weed issue -- that is one of the things they are truly on top of. It is to the best interest of the developer to have the property well maintained.

Sadly, I'd call the sheriff about the barking dogs. If they aren't the proper authorities, I'm sure they could steer you to the correct authority.

BTW, if the property is on Henderson, the weeds in the flower beds and hedeges will be taken care of this week (the grass is someone else's responsibility).
